Who We Are
Waterfront Restoration and Jingle Bulbs Christmas Lighting are Minnesota-based seasonal service companies. We remove lake weeds in the summer and install custom holiday lighting displays in the winter. Our mission? Make lakes enjoyable and homes magical.
and
Position Overview
We're looking for a methodical executor. Someone who thrives on checklists, timelines, clean systems, and well-run processes.If you're the kind of person who catches typos no one else sees, color-codes your Google Drive folders, and always knows what's due next week (and who's responsible for it), you'll love this role.
Your focus will be to help execute structured marketing plans, coordinate seasonal operations, and manage internal projects. You'll own the details, keep our systems tight, and support a smooth rhythm of work across two seasonal businesses.
This role is perfect for someone who thrives in an orderly, behind-the-scenes role - keeping projects moving, organizing data and checklists, and making sure the trains run on time.
This Role Is NOT: Strategic marketing planning - the plan is already mostly built; your job will be to carry it out.
It is also not Design-focused - basic formatting is helpful, but no graphic design is required.
Key Responsibilities
Marketing Operations
- Manage and send email, social media, and print marketing campaigns
- Maintain marketing calendars, templates, contact lists, and content libraries
- Format and prepare flyers, postcards and postcard lists, and proposals
- Track campaign data and organize it for easy reporting
Client & Project Support
- Occasionally send proposals and quotes to clients
- Track seasonal project timelines and ensure nothing slips through the cracks
- Keep client experiences consistent by managing documentation and internal feedback
- Ensure repeatable task lists are completed consistently
Team Support & Admin
- Manage interns and part-time employee onboarding and scheduling
- Review resumes, organize applications, and conduct interviews
- Manage projects using Asana
- Provide administrative support to the sales team
Data & Process Management
- Use Excel and CRM tools to organize data and generate reports
- Help update and maintain internal systems for tracking performance
- Recommend and implement process improvements (templates, SOPs, etc.)
